Though London Waterloo East is a bustling hub, it provides essential amenities to ensure a smooth experience for travelers. While it lacks a traditional ticket office, fear not—ticket machines are readily available for both purchase and collection of pre-booked tickets. Accessibility is thoughtfully catered for, with accessible ticket machines and step-free access via lifts from Waterloo Main station. Need assistance? Help points are clearly marked, and staff are on hand to lend a helping hand when needed.
For those traveling with youngsters or seeking some comfort, the station hosts heated waiting rooms and accessible toilets with baby-changing facilities. CCTV surveillance is in place to ensure a secure environment throughout your journey. Hungry or in need of caffeine fix? Grab a snack or a hot drink from the coffee shops and vending machines on site—no worries about missing the news as newspapers are available too!
Transportation links play a crucial role in making your journey seamless. London Waterloo East does not disappoint with its comprehensive connections to other parts of the city. The bus alighting point on Sandell Street ensures easy access to local transit and rail replacement services. Halling station might not boast a grand array of facilities, but it provides essential services to ensure a smooth journey. The station doesn’t have a ticket office, however, it offers ticket machines where you can collect tickets booked online. These machines are accessible and located at the entrance to platform 1. Passengers with hearing impairments will appreciate the induction loops available on-site.
While the station lacks amenities such as lounges, toilets, and shops, there are seating areas available for passengers to wait comfortably. Unfortunately, for those requiring step-free access, it is important to highlight that while platform 1 for services to Strood offers step-free access, platform 2 towards Paddock Wood does not.
Connections from Halling station make exploring the broader region straightforward and convenient. The station links well with various modes of public transport, including buses. If you're looking to continue your journey by bus, local Arriva buses serve destinations towards Maidstone and Strood, with stops conveniently located near the station.
